La Bazoge, a region in the Sarthe department of France, offers a diverse landscape for outdoor pursuits. Located just north of Le Mans, the area features a mix of verdant forests, tranquil lakes, and paths along the Sarthe Valley. This blend of natural settings provides opportunities for several sports like touring cycling, hiking, road cycling, jogging, and more.

La Bazoge offers a variety of outdoor activities including Touring cycling, Hiking, Road cycling, Jogging, Mountain biking, and Gravel biking. The region features diverse landscapes suitable for different types of outdoor pursuits.
La Bazoge provides numerous cycling routes, from paved surfaces to more challenging unpaved segments. Cyclists can explore loops around Souilly, Crucé mill in Teillé, and the Lac de la Bazoge. For detailed information, consult the Cycling around La Bazoge guide.
Yes, hiking is a prominent activity in La Bazoge, with numerous marked trails. A popular itinerary is "La forêt de La Bazoge et l'étang des Aulnes – boucle depuis La Bazoge," an 7.4-mile [11.9 km] trail. More options are available in the Hiking around La Bazoge guide.
La Bazoge is well-suited for road cycling, featuring routes that primarily use small, low-traffic roads. Some routes, like "NORTH OF MAND 48 km" and "PARCOURS VELO (NO Le Mans) 55km," include significant climbs. The area has even been a sprint point in professional cycling events. La Bazoge offers opportunities for mountain biking, with trails that include unpaved segments. These routes require good fitness due to varying terrain. For specific routes and details, refer to the MTB Trails around La Bazoge guide.
The region offers diverse routes, including easier loops suitable for families and beginners. Many cycling and hiking paths are accessible and provide a pleasant experience for all fitness levels. The extensive network of paths allows for varied choices.
La Bazoge is characterized by its natural charm, including the Forêt de La Bazoge, which offers shaded paths. Several lakes and ponds, such as the Plan d'eau des Aulnes and the Lac de la Bazoge – Etang de la Bazoge, provide picturesque scenery. The nearby Sarthe Valley also contributes to the scenic beauty.
